Output 3f39a2433e851aca7e83412d74c83ebd0c40bffc142518c6d0200521b8f38c72:3

value
112320654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764eab0a1a4903324101e4218874f311986cab6b OP_EQUAL
address
MJgiD2JEfe37ihRnhLcUdaTrgDrQ2gRdBQ
transaction
3f39a2433e851aca7e83412d74c83ebd0c40bffc142518c6d0200521b8f38c72
spent
true